#1166 If you are not describing a succession of events, that sentence is perfect as it is. When you describe an event that started in the past and has an effect in the moment of speaking, you usually use the present perfect, like in this case since it's pretty obvious that the success is remarkable nowadays.

#1167 When you turn a name into an adjective by adding either -ing or -ed get used to employ -ing when you "produce" that thing and -ed when you "have" or "recieve" whatever you are talking about.

In this case, since you are turning "interest" into an adjective, you'd use "interesting" when you produce such an interest and "interested" when you have the interest.

By the way, in English you write "P.S." (from latin Post Scriptum), rather than "P.D." ^^
